Add objects with varying heights
After I place the garland, I like to add in decor of varying heights. Above, I used a mix of glass candleholders, green taper candle holders, a pot filled with a faux tree, and a few shorter, white birds.
You could use a mix of whatever you love! For example, a set of glass trees, wood taper candles, glass votive candles, decorative figurines, faux trees & more! You want objects that sit lower in height like the birds above, mixed in with taller items like taper candles or faux trees.

I like to use a simple stocking holder as to not draw attention away from the rest of the decor. I also like to hang our stockings on opposite sides of the fireplace- a grouping of 2 and 1 on the opposite side.
